Title: The Innovative Mind of Roderick Farrell

Introduction

Roderick Farrell is a notable inventor based in Ottawa, Canada. He has made significant contributions to the field of safety equipment with a focus on protective gear. With a total of two patents to his name, Roderick continues to be a key figure in innovation at his company.

Latest Patents

Among his achievements, Roderick’s latest invention is a protective helmet designed to enhance safety for users in various environments. His patents reflect his commitment to improving protection through innovative design and technology.

Career Highlights

Roderick Farrell is currently employed at Med-Eng Systems Inc., a company that specializes in advanced safety solutions and personal protective equipment. His role within the company allows him to actively engage in research and development, contributing his inventive skills to the advancement of safety technologies.

Collaborations

Roderick collaborates with several talented individuals, including coworkers Aristidis Makris and Jay Richard Sobel. These collaborations enable him to combine ideas and expertise, fostering an environment of creativity and innovation within his field.
